How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Doss?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Doss Studio Apartments | $1,155 | $905 | $1,310 |
Doss 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,270 | $678 | $1,689 |
Doss 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,509 | $567 | $2,178 |
Doss 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,778 | $1,075 | $2,355 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Doss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Doss with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Doss is at TownePark Fredericksburg listed at $567.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Doss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Doss is $1,509.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Doss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Doss is a 1,174 square feet unit starting from $1,449 at Prose Thunder Rock.
What is the average size for Doss 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Doss is currently 1,217 sq ft.
